Q150 Is there concern that there might be a decrease in the number of employers?

A150 The closing of factories in Japan did lead to an increase in unemployment levels. Employees who could no longer be carried by the manufacturing industry could not switch quickly from manufacturing to service industries. In recent years, however, unemployment levels have been falling and the migration of people from manufacturing to service industries has been smooth. The long-term trend of falling employee numbers in manufacturing industries has bottomed out and, since 2005, the trend has been reversing, albeit slowly. As of August 2006, 11.73 million people were employed in manufacturing, an increase of 300,000 from the 2005 low.
